首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

未更新Vue数组内容

Vue是一种流行的前端开发框架,用于构建用户界面。在Vue中,如果要更新数组的内容,可以使用Vue提供的一些方法和技巧。

  1. 使用Vue.set方法:Vue.set方法可以用于向数组中添加新的元素,并触发视图更新。例如:
代码语言:txt
复制
Vue.set(array, index, newValue);

其中,array是要更新的数组,index是要更新的元素的索引,newValue是要更新的新值。

  1. 使用splice方法:splice方法可以用于删除、替换或添加数组中的元素,并触发视图更新。例如:
代码语言:txt
复制
array.splice(index, 1, newValue);

其中,index是要更新的元素的索引,1表示要删除的元素数量(如果不删除元素,则为0),newValue是要更新的新值。

  1. 使用Vue.set或splice方法的替代方法:如果需要更新整个数组,可以创建一个新的数组,并将其赋值给原始数组的引用。例如:
代码语言:txt
复制
array = [...newArray];

这将创建一个新的数组newArray,并将其赋值给原始数组array的引用,从而触发视图更新。

对于Vue数组内容的更新,可以应用于各种场景,例如:

  • 在表单中动态添加或删除表单项时,可以使用Vue.set或splice方法更新数组内容。
  • 在展示列表数据时,可以使用Vue.set或splice方法更新数组内容。
  • 在实现拖拽排序功能时,可以使用Vue.set或splice方法更新数组内容。

对于Vue数组内容的更新,腾讯云提供了一些相关产品和服务,例如:

  • 腾讯云对象存储(COS):用于存储和管理大规模的非结构化数据,可以将数组内容存储在COS中,并通过API进行读写操作。产品介绍链接:https://cloud.tencent.com/product/cos
  • 腾讯云云数据库MongoDB:用于存储和管理结构化数据,可以将数组内容存储在MongoDB中,并通过API进行读写操作。产品介绍链接:https://cloud.tencent.com/product/mongodb

请注意,以上只是一些示例,实际上腾讯云提供了更多与云计算相关的产品和服务,可以根据具体需求选择适合的产品。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Vue视图未更新再次踩坑

今天遇到一个Vue数据更新了,但是视图未更新的问题,折腾了我2小时才搞定,有必要记录下来,防止日后再次踩坑。 问题描述 我需要显示一个列表,而且列表是可编辑的。比如可以修改列表每一项的名称等。...$forceUpdate(); // 加上视图才会更新 }, 按照以往的经验,只有直接赋值的时候editing=false,才会数据更新,但是视图未更新,但是我现在已经使用了this....在网上搜寻的过程中,我发现了有人问,为什么数据更新了,但是Vue Devtools中的数据未更新?.../issues/41#issuecomment-162675083 其实,如果页面上没有任何可响应的内容,也就是页面未使用响应式的数据,或者使用了非响应式的数据,那么数据将无法在Vue Devtools...如果页面未使用响应式的数据,或者使用了非响应式的数据,Vue DevTools的数据是不会更新的。

1.1K10
  • vue数组更新界面无变化

    1. vue数组更新界面无变化 1.1....说明 对数组进行更新或者添加,一定要注意方式,我的情况是数组套数组,双重循环,在造数据的时候,不断从尾部添加数据,所以写成了如下形式,每次下拉都会去加载一批相同的数据添加到尾部。...解决 问题的根源请看这篇 由于 JavaScript 的限制,Vue 不能检测以下数组的变动: 当你利用索引直接设置一个数组项时,例如:vm.items[indexOfItem] = newValue...当你修改数组的长度时,例如:vm.items.length = newLength 解决方法请参考上面的链接,我这里给出我的代码的改法 this.arrList[this.arrList.length...总结 vue里还是有些方法不能进行数据绑定的操作的,对这些方法还是要着重看下,理解下

    61520

    数组(更新...)

    在学习语言时,我们都会遇到数组.大学期间学过C,C++,Java,C#.这些语言中都学了数组,那时候用的不多,概念比较模糊,现在又学了php,里面也有数组,就打算写一篇笔记总结下不同语言的数组之间的异同...首先看下C是怎么定义数组的: C 语言支持数组数据结构,它可以存储一个固定大小的相同类型元素的顺序集合。数组是用来存储一系列数据,但它往往被认为是一系列相同类型的变量。...初始化二维数组 多维数组可以通过在括号内为每行指定值来进行初始化。...通过指定不带索引的数组名称来给函数传递一个指向数组的指针。...但是,可以通过指定不带索引的数组名来返回一个指向数组的指针。再来学习本章的内容。如果想要从函数返回一个一维数组,必须声明一个返回指针的函数.

    98930

    【数据库报错(未删除任何行,未更新任何行)】

    数据库报错(未删除任何行,未更新任何行) 报错 报错如图: 数据库更新表格时,提示如下错误弹框 解决方法 首先查看定义的表格数据类型有无问题,点击表格编辑前100行 如何更改编辑行数:更改编辑行数...这里的允许NULL值为通过输入端输入后,写进数据库是否包含空值 例如,输入端通过注册输入注册名后,若允许NULL值未勾选,则写进表格的为用户名+数据类型除了用户名所占字节剩余用空格进行填充(写入表格中的数据为用户名...+若干空格) 若允许NULL值勾选了,则写进表格的即为刚刚进行注册的用户名,其后没有多余空格 更新表格之后,若直接在更新的数据之后右键执行,是不可以的,会报错。...正确的做法为,选择表格最下方NULL,右键执行,即可更新数据库表。

    37540

    Android 13 SDK更新内容

    添加此标志可阻止敏感内容出现在内容预览中。(堵死通过剪贴板预览功能获取敏感信息的漏洞。)...(如果你已经用了该ID,不要轻易去掉,容易造成应用更新失败。)...新增: OpenJDK 11更新:Android 13 开始刷新 Android 的核心库,以与 OpenJDK 11 LTS 版本保持一致,并增添了适合应用和平台开发者的库更新和 Java 11 语言支持...在 Android 13 中,应用可以调用新的文本转换 API,以便用户更快、更轻松地找到所需内容。 Unicode库更新:针对多语种的开发者,需要了解的。国内开发,需要关注的不太多。...复制和粘贴方面的改进:向剪贴板中添加内容时,系统会显示标准视觉确认界面,以便用户预览和修改复制的内容。 新的系统级无障碍功能偏好设置:允许用户跨所有应用启用音频说明。

    2.1K10
    领券